CHINE, XVIIIe siècle* - Lot 55
CHINE, XVIIIe siècle* Small porcelain teapot With globular body, straight spout and opposite ear handle, decorated with polychrome enamels on a white background of carp in the sea, the lower part molded with lotus petals, resting on stems treated in high relief, the lid in the imitation of a lotus leaf, a stem forming the button of gripping Height : 12 cm
